Oprah Winfrey delighted graduates at her alma mater Tennessee State University on Saturday, telling the story of how she fell one credit short of graduating as she launched the media career that would make her a household name.

Beginning the second semester of her sophomore year, Winfrey arranged to finish her classes by 2:00 p.m. so she could work at the television station from 2:30 to 10:30 and be home by her father's 11:00 p.m. curfew. Her success in life has come from God's grace and from listening to what she called the “still, small voice" inside while filtering out the noise of the world. That way “you begin to know your own heart and figure out what matters most,” Winfrey said. “Every right move I've made has come from listening deeply and following that still, small voice."“Unfortunately, you are going to encounter people who insist that it's not actually possible to make any difference,” she said.
